Oberer Kleineisersee
Oberer Kleineisersee is a lake in Salzburg, Austria and has an elevation of 2,642 metres. Oberer Kleineisersee is situated nearby to the locality Eisboden, as well as near the hamlet Enzingerboden.Places of Interest

Hocheiser is a mountain in the Glockner Group of the High Tauern in the state of Salzburg, Austria. Located between the Stubach and Kaprun valleys, Hocheiser is an impressive sight from the west.
